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Amazonian manatee | Marsh Valerian |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Sirenia (Sirenia) | Dipsacales (Dipsacales) |
| Family | Trichechidae | Caprifoliaceae |
| Genus | Trichechus | Valeriana |
| Species | Trichechus inunguis | Valeriana uliginosa |
